Why Drying Your Car Properly Matters

Drying your car after washing is not just about aesthetics; it's a crucial step in maintaining your vehicle's appearance and protecting its paintwork. The method you choose can make a significant difference in the long-term condition of your car. 


Here's why it matters and why using a microfiber towel is often the preferred choice for car enthusiasts and detailers alike.

  1. Efficient Moisture Removal: A microfiber towel is highly effective at absorbing moisture, ensuring that your car's surface is left completely dry. This is important because lingering moisture can lead to water spots, which can be difficult to remove and can damage the paint over time.
  2. Residue Removal: Microfiber towels excel at picking up any residue left behind by cleaning products. This includes dirt particles that may have been missed during the washing process. By thoroughly drying your car with a Car wash mitt microfiber towel, you're ensuring that all contaminants are removed, leaving behind a clean and shiny finish.
  3. Non-Abrasive: One of the biggest advantages of using a microfiber towel is it is non-abrasive. Unlike traditional towels or chamois cloths, which can potentially scratch the paint surface, microfiber towels are gentle and won't cause damage, even with repeated use.
  4. Durability: Microfiber towels are known for their durability. They can withstand multiple washes without losing their effectiveness or shedding fibers, ensuring that you can continue to use them for a long time without needing frequent replacements.
  5. Versatility: Microfiber towels can be used for various detailing tasks beyond drying, such as applying wax or polish. This makes them a valuable tool to have in your car care and cleaning arsenal.

 

Best Method for Drying Your Car

To get the most out of your microfiber towel when drying your car, follow these steps:

  1. Preparation: Before using the towel, wring it out with cold water to remove any excess moisture. Avoid using any cleaning products at this stage to prevent streaks or marks on the paintwork.
  2. Drying Process: Open out the dry towel and systematically pass it over the car's bodywork, using an open hand to maneuver it. Make sure to wring out the towel and check for cleanliness regularly, especially if it picks up a lot of dirt.
  3. Finishing Touches: Once you've dried the car's entire surface, allow any remaining moisture to evaporate naturally. This will help ensure a streak-free finish and enhance the overall shine of your vehicle.
